Doncaster hit back to put four past Walsall



Posted Sunday, September 16, 2018 by PA

Doncaster hit back to put four past Walsall

Doncaster came from behind to claim a thumping 4-1 win at Walsall as the hosts’ unbeaten League One start to the season bit the dust.

Walsall threatened after 10 minutes as Luke Leahy’s defence-splitting pass freed Josh Ginnelly but he curled inches wide from 18 yards.

Rovers went close five minutes later as ex-Saddlers skipper Andy Butler glanced a header wide from Danny Andrew’s cross.

Butler gifted his old team the opener after 17 minutes as his mistimed header from a Ginnelly cross set up Morgan Ferrier to nod home from a couple of yards.

But Doncaster levelled zfter 33 minutes as Leahy handled a high ball and John Marquis tucked home his fourth league goal of the season from the spot.

Doncaster keeper Marko Marosi impressively foiled Ferrier’s six-yard strike after the break before Rovers led as Leeds loanee Mallik Wilks drilled past Liam Roberts at his near post.

Wilks’ surging run set up James Coppinger to curl home a fine third before Matty Blair lashed in Rovers’ fourth from 12 yards in stoppage time.
